Home
last modified time | relevance | path

Searched refs:segment_ratio (Results 1 – 6 of 6) sorted by relevance

/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/mapbox-gl-native/deps/boost/1.65.1/include/boost/geometry/policies/robustness/
H A Dsegment_ratio.hpp27 namespace detail { namespace segment_ratio namespace
105 class segment_ratio class
111 typedef segment_ratio<Type> thistype;
113 inline segment_ratio() in segment_ratio() function in boost::geometry::segment_ratio
119 inline segment_ratio(const Type& nominator, const Type& denominator) in segment_ratio() function in boost::geometry::segment_ratio
202 ? detail::segment_ratio::less<Type>::apply(*this, other) in operator <()
209 && detail::segment_ratio::equal<Type>::apply(*this, other); in operator ==()
225 friend std::ostream& operator<<(std::ostream &os, segment_ratio const& ratio) in operator <<()
H A Dno_rescale_policy.hpp60 typedef segment_ratio<coordinate_type> type;
H A Drescale_policy.hpp81 typedef segment_ratio<boost::long_long_type> type;
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/mapbox-gl-native/deps/boost/1.65.1/include/boost/geometry/strategies/geographic/
H A Dintersection.hpp525 segment_ratio<calc_t> ra_from(dist_b1_a1, dist_b1_b2); in apply()
526 segment_ratio<calc_t> ra_to(dist_b1_a2, dist_b1_b2); in apply()
527 segment_ratio<calc_t> rb_from(dist_a1_b1, dist_a1_a2); in apply()
528 segment_ratio<calc_t> rb_to(dist_a1_b2, dist_a1_a2); in apply()
579 segment_ratio<calc_t> in apply()
621 … return Policy::one_degenerate(segment, segment_ratio<CalcT>(dist_1_o, dist_1_2), degenerated_a); in collinear_one_degenerated()
674 return segment_ratio<CalcT>(dist_a1_bi, dist_a1_a2).on_segment(); in calculate_collinear_data()
834 bool is_on_a = segment_ratio<CalcT>(dist_a1_ip, dist_a1_a2).on_segment(); in calculate_ip_data()
851 bool is_on_b = segment_ratio<CalcT>(dist_b1_ip, dist_b1_b2).on_segment(); in calculate_ip_data()
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/mapbox-gl-native/deps/boost/1.65.1/include/boost/geometry/strategies/spherical/
H A Dintersection.hpp467 segment_ratio<calc_t> ra_from(dist_b1_a1, dist_b1_b2); in apply()
468 segment_ratio<calc_t> ra_to(dist_b1_a2, dist_b1_b2); in apply()
469 segment_ratio<calc_t> rb_from(dist_a1_b1, dist_a1_a2); in apply()
470 segment_ratio<calc_t> rb_to(dist_a1_b2, dist_a1_a2); in apply()
531 segment_ratio<calc_t>, in apply()
564 … : Policy::one_degenerate(segment, segment_ratio<CalcT>(dist_1_o, dist_1_2), degenerated_a); in collinear_one_degenerated()
616 return segment_ratio<CalcT>(dist_a1_i1, dist_a1_a2).on_segment(); in calculate_collinear_data()
839 is_on_a = segment_ratio<CalcT>(dist_a1_i1, dist_a1_a2).on_segment(); in is_potentially_crossing()
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/mapbox-gl-native/deps/boost/1.65.1/include/boost/geometry/algorithms/detail/is_simple/
H A Dlinear.hpp201 geometry::segment_ratio in has_self_intersections()